Dr. Schultz passed away on 24th of August 2024, at the age of 93. Her husband Dr. Harold Seftel, died on December 3rd 2023. They are survived by their children Lisa, David, Colin and Mark, and their grandchildren Nompilo, Thuthuka and Aiden.

She was a retired medical practitioner whose passionate interest was community medicine. She worked for many years in ambulatory medical care in the public sector in underserved urban and rural areas in South Africa. She observed and experienced the impact of social, political and economic factors on the provision of and access to medical services, and on the health and well-being of the people of this country. The proposals, reports, documents, comments, protocols and guidelines on this site reflect this.

Because she was the mother of five children, she had little time to prepare material for publication. She was not formally attached to any academic institution. Additionally she was often harassed and restrained by bureaucracy. She always worked with patients and not at a desk. She therefore welcomed the opportunity provided by the internet to share her experience and ideas with others.

She was passionately opposed to the consumption of sugar, sodium chloride (salt) and processed foods.
